The construction of data centers should fully consider the changing requirements of future development and meet the ability to process big data. Starting from the structured cabling architecture, in the original EoR, MoR, ToR three-layer network architecture system, seek new ways to connect with the AI network architecture to achieve continuous transformation and improvement of data processing capabilities. The cabling system needs to support network architectures such as Spine-Leaf, POD-Spine, Full-Mesh, and data center network upgrades (such as 40G/100G to 400G) to achieve effective interconnection of "computing network, intranet, extranet, and storage network."
AI server room structured cabling
For the connection between devices, it is recommended to use high-performance, low-loss multimode OM4/OM5 fiber cores, and for long-distance transmission, the bending-resistant single-mode OS2 fiber core should be selected. MPO should use high-quality, low-loss connectors to meet current network transmission requirements and can also be used for future product upgrades. Uniboot connectors can be considered in high-density environments. During the design process, cabling products are tailored according to actual applications to ensure that the overall link loss of different structured cabling meets industry standards.
